2019 Garden Update

8/14/2019

 
Our growing season has been going really well, though some more rain could come in handy.

We have enjoyed a bounty of cucumbers, with our tomatoes ripening a slow bit at a time. Our garden herbs include only basil and thyme after the caterpillars ate through the dill and parsley. The good news is we've been able to harvest hundreds of dill seeds, which will be used for the next growing season.

As of August 13th, we have harvested a total of:
3lbs of mixed herbs
14.6lbs cucumbers
6.5lb tomatoes

All this was grown right here in Brooklyn, and cared for by young scientists age 2 to 12.
